Here's some good news for you from Karpro. He's a Ford sales guy.

Good News for those waiting for their car
Ford bumped the rebate on both the 2011 V6 and GT to $1000 this morning. The program number is still 11818.

The top tier finance rate also dropped to 1.9/2.9/3.9/5.9% for 36/48/60/72 months but these two programs are not compatible with each other. This is program #20252.

They work quite well. We have patrol cars and the helicopter equipped with LoJack receivers. We still have to search and follow the arrows until we find the car though so the faster it's activated the better.


The only thing I can think of that would be better is if there is a GPS based system that would give the exact location. I have no idea if an alarm system like that exists though.
